Historic cinema in Brixton

The "Ritzy Cinema and Cafe" in London, England, is a cultural gem in the vibrant district of Brixton, combining the allure of a historic cinema with a welcoming café and bar area. Part of the Picturehouse Cinemas chain, known for its independent and characterful cinemas, the Ritzy has established itself as a staple of the community since its opening in 1911. Originally built as the "Electric Pavilion," it is one of the oldest surviving cinemas in England and a Grade II listed building. Today, it features five screens and offers a mix of blockbusters, independent films, and special events that enrich the cultural life of South London.

Café with live music events

Upon entering the "Ritzy Cinema and Cafe," visitors are greeted by a charming ambiance that blends the building's history with modern elements. The main auditorium retains the glamour of the early cinema days with its impressive architecture, while the smaller screens create an intimate atmosphere. The café area, located on the ground floor, is a popular meeting spot, characterized by its relaxed vibe and friendly service. Here, you find a colorful mix of film enthusiasts enjoying a snack before or after a show, as well as guests simply soaking in the lively Brixton atmosphere. Upstairs, known as "Upstairs at the Ritzy," the space transforms into a venue for live music, comedy nights, and DJ sets, adding an extra cultural dimension to the establishment. In nice weather, the outdoor seating area offers views of the surroundings and invites guests to linger.

Best pizza at Ritzy café

Culinary offerings at the café in the "Ritzy Cinema and Cafe" include a selection of dishes perfectly suited for a cinema visit or a leisurely stay. Highlights include the crispy Margherita pizza, topped with fresh basil and a rich tomato sauce—simple yet flavorful, making it ideal to pair with a drink. The falafel wraps, served with a spicy tahini sauce, are also popular, providing a light but satisfying option. For those with a sweet tooth, the chocolate brownie is a tempting treat that strikes the perfect balance with its moist texture and a hint of salt. The drinks menu is equally diverse, featuring a selection of local beers, wines, and refreshing cocktails that complement the food well. Since the restaurant was taken over by "En Root," there has been a stronger focus on vegan and Indian-inspired street food options, expanding the offerings and introducing new flavors.

Cultural meeting spots in London

The "Ritzy Cinema and Cafe" places great importance on service and accessibility. The staff is known for their friendliness and willingness to help, whether recommending a film or serving in the café. The venue also offers special screenings like "Relaxed Screenings" for neurodivergent guests or people with dementia, as well as "Watch with Baby" screenings for parents with toddlers, emphasizing its inclusive philosophy. The combination of cinema and café makes it a flexible venue for various occasions—whether for a spontaneous movie night, a gathering with friends, or a light lunch after wandering through Brixton. It is also a popular spot for groups looking to take advantage of the cultural events happening upstairs.
